Joos de Momper the Younger or Joost de Momper the Younger [alternative spellings of first name: Jodocus, Joes, Joeys and Josse] (1564–1635) was one of the foremost Flemish landscape painters between Pieter Brueghel the Elder and Peter Paul Rubens. Brueghel's influence is clearly evident in many of de Momper's paintings.
